四级阅读击破:篇章词汇阅读篇4

http://www.wmmenglish.com  更新时间:2008-9-9   点击数:   来源:网络

  Passage 4
  Sport is not only physically challenging, but it can also be mentally challenging. Criticismfrom coaches, parents, and other teammates, as well as pressure to win can create an excessiveamount of __1__ or stress for young athletes. Stress can be physical, emotional, or psychologicaland research has indicated that it can lead to burnout. Burnout has been described as __2__ orquitting of an activity that was at one time enjoyable.The early years of development are __3__ years for learning about oneself. The sport settingis one where valuable experiences can take place. Young athletes can, for example, learn how to__4__ with others, make friends, and gain other social skills that will be used throughout their lives.Coaches and parents should be aware, at all times, that their feedback to youngsters can __5__affect their children. Youngsters may take their parents’ and coaches’ criticisms to heart and find aflaw(缺陷)in themselves.Coaches and parents should also be __6__ that youth sport participation does not become workfor children. That outcome of the game should not be more important than the __7__ of learning thesport and other life lessons. In today’s youth sport setting, young athletes may be worrying moreabout who will win instead of __8__ themselves and the sport. Following a game many parents andcoaches __9__ on the outcome and find fault with youngsters’ performances. Positive reinforcementshould be provided regardless of the outcome. Research indicates that positive reinforcement motivatesand has a greater effect on learning that criticism. Again, criticism can create __10__ levels of stress,which can lead to burnout.A)process B)high C)enjoying   D)anxietyE)settle F)cautious G)cooperate   H)greatlyI)dropping J)hardly K)intense L)focusM)aspiration N)critical O)procedure

  ANSWERS:1.选D)。 由or可知,此处应填名词,并且所填名词和stress词语词性相同,选项中有anxiety和aspiration,但由最后一段中worryingmore可推出,压力会给运动员造成过多的焦虑,而不是渴望,故排除aspiration而选anxiety。
  2.选I)。由or可知, 此处应填动词的现在分词形式,且表达的意思应与quitting相近,故排除选项中的enjoying而选dropping“不再做(某事)”。
  3.选N)。此处应填形容词。从原文“成长过程的最初几年是了解自己的......时期。”可选项有cautious和critical,由后文中的valuable experiences和be used throughout their lives可推出,成长的最初几年是了解自己的关键时期,而不是谨慎时期。故排除cautious而选critical。
  4.选G)。此处应填动词, 且能与with构成搭配。可选项有settle和cooperate,而settle with sb. 意为“同某人解决(法律上的争端)",显然不符合题意,因此选cooperate“合作”。
  5.选H)。此处应填副词。可选项有greatly和hardly,由take......to heart可推出,教练和父母的反馈信息会极大地影响年轻运动员,故排除hardly而选greatly。
  6.选F)。由also可知, 此处应填与aware对应的形容词。因此,可选项有cautious和critical,但that从句解释的是参与体育运动不能成为孩子们的工作,故只有cautious符合题意。
  7.选A)。此处应填名词。由that可知,此处应填与outcome意思相反的词,故只有process“过程”符合题意,选项中procedure强调的是“程序”,故排除。
  8.选C)。由句中的instead of可知,此处应填动词的现在分词形式。根据worrying和instead of可推出,此处应填与worrying意思相反的词,因此,选项中只有enjoying符合题意。
  9.选L)。此处应填动词,且能与on构成搭配。可选项有settle和focus,但从句意来理解,比赛后,许多父母和教练......比赛结果,而且总是在挑剔年轻人在比赛中的表现。settle on“决定,同意:,显然与句意不符,故排除settle而选focus,focus on在此意为“看重".
  10.选B)。此处应填形容词。但选项中的形容词有high和intense,应为这个形容词由来修饰名词level,而intense表示“紧张的,强烈的”不能用来修饰level,故选择high。
